Position We're looking for a proactive and detail-oriented Procurement Specialist to join our Global Procurement team, reporting directly to the Head of Procurement. In this role, you'll play a key part in managing sourcing activities, optimizing procurement strategies, and supporting project delivery in a dynamic and international environment.

What You'll Do
* Prepare and issue RFIs and RFQs
* Analyse and compare supplier offers (pricing, T&Cs, lead time, scope of supply and exclusions)
* Support negotiations and contribute to supplier selection aligned with project requirements, budget, and timelines
* Manage procurement processes end-to-end, ensuring compliance during negotiation and contracting phases
* Collaborate daily with Project Managers, Engineers, Site Managers, and project teams
* Build strong relationships with internal stakeholders, understanding business priorities and aligning procurement strategies accordingly
* Monitor procurement budgets and promote a culture of cost optimization
* Define and track KPIs to monitor performance, compliance, process efficiency, and stakeholder satisfaction
* Proactively identify and mitigate risks, ensuring timely resolution of supply issues
* Maintain and update vendor lists (direct and indirect) through internal tools and vendor portals
